I just had a tree service guy leave after taking a big tree down for me. The tree was a huge spreading maple on the corner of my driveway. It was four feet in diameter at the base and overhung utility wires, and our house and was dead down to the ground in a split. I had called a guy that had taken some limbs out of it a few years ago but he was away for an extended time. He told me what to expect to pay and told me that he would call a friend that could do it. After not hearing from that guy after two days, I went by the place of a local guy who I knew is supposed to be good but I had heard that he was also expensive. He looked at it and gave me a price that was considerably less than the first guy. Well, he came over this AM with a bucket truck and two helpers. I expected him to have to lower branches with rope but he didn't. He cut them all from the bucket and guided them to fall the right way with his saw and his hand. Even the ones over the house and the wires. He was like an artist with a saw instead of a brush. He was done and gone in two and a quarter hours, and saved me money.
